Lando Norris and Lewis Hamilton shared an awkward moment in the cool down room following the remarkable Hungarian Grand Prix.

It was a race in which tempers flared, with the McLaren driver forced to hand over victory to team-mate Oscar Piastri.

After the difficult episode for the Woking team, its last drivers' champion tried to break the ice, but found himself on the receiving end of an odd comment from Norris, who also tossed his second-place finisher cap on the floor.

Hamilton: "Whoo, you guys are fast [to Norris and Oscar Piastri]"

Norris: "Yeah, well, you had a fast car seven years ago."

Hamilton: "Seven years ago? That's a long time. Were you here seven years ago?"

Norris: "You know, you had a quick car. You made the most of it, now it's us."

Hamilton: "I wasn't complaining, I was just complimenting you on your car."

The clip was shared on Formula 1's social media channels with the caption "Tense times in the cool down room".

The comments are full of incomprehension at the way Norris attacks Hamilton after what was clearly meant to be a friendly and sincere ice breaker.
